The "Idas Starter Kit .rar" refers to a essential collection of tools and configuration files used by the gaming community to set up Initial D Arcade Stage (IDAS) games on PC. These kits are primarily designed to work with the TeknoParrot emulator, which allows users to play arcade-perfect versions of the racing series at home. What is Inside an IDAS Starter Kit?

A typical starter kit is a compressed archive containing the necessary "glue" to make the arcade software functional on a standard Windows environment. Common components include:

Card Editors & Launchers: Tools like the InitialD Arcade Stage Launcher allow you to manage virtual "save cards," edit your driver profile, and unlock car slots without needing a physical arcade machine.

Translation Patches: Since most IDAS titles (like Arcade Stage 8 Infinity) were released exclusively in Japan, these kits often include English translation files to navigate menus.

Resolution & FOV Fixes: Scripts or .ini modifiers that enable widescreen support and adjust the field of view for modern PC monitors.

Shaders & Graphical Tweaks: Optional enhancements to improve the visual fidelity of older titles like IDAS 6 AA or 7 AAX. How to Use the Starter Kit

Setting up the game usually requires a specific workflow to ensure the emulator recognizes the files correctly.

Download the Base Game: You must acquire the game dump files separately, as "Starter Kits" usually only contain the configuration tools, not the massive game assets themselves.

Install TeknoParrot: Most modern setups require the TeknoParrot emulator to bridge the gap between arcade hardware and PC architecture.

Extract the .rar: Use a tool like WinRAR or 7-Zip to unpack the kit into your game directory.

Configure Controls: Map your steering wheel or controller buttons using the emulator's input settings. Safety and Security Considerations

While not a single "official" product, "Idas Starter Kit" is a common name for community-driven bundles designed to make IDA Pro more powerful and user-friendly right out of the box. These kits are often shared on developer forums, GitHub, or specialized reverse engineering sites to help beginners and professionals streamline their workflow. Common Contents of the Archive A typical "Starter Kit" for IDA usually includes:

Essential Plugins: Tools like Hex-Rays Decompiler helpers, Keypatch (for patching binaries), and LazyIDA (for quick data conversion).

Scripts: Python scripts (IDAPython) for automating repetitive tasks like string decryption or function renaming. "Idas" : This is almost certainly a typo

Custom Themes: Configuration files (.clr or CSS) to change IDA’s default interface to dark mode or other high-contrast schemes.

Signature Files (FLIRT): Libraries that help IDA recognize standard library functions in various compilers, improving the quality of the disassembly.

Documentation: Cheat sheets for keyboard shortcuts and basic tutorials for navigating the interface. Security Warning

Because .rar files containing executable scripts and plugins are easily weaponized, you should exercise extreme caution when downloading such kits from unofficial sources:

Scan for Malware: Always run the archive through tools like VirusTotal before extracting.

Verify the Source: Only download kits from reputable contributors on platforms like GitHub or well-known security forums.

Use a Sandbox: It is best practice to extract and use these kits within a Virtual Machine (VM) to prevent potential system infection. Why Use a Starter Kit?

Efficiency: Saves hours of manually hunting for and installing individual plugins.

Standardization: Helps teams use the same set of tools and scripts for collaborative analysis.

Learning Curve: Provides beginners with a "best-of" selection of tools that experts use daily.
